**Q: Why does Driftpane choke on files over 50 MB?**

A: It doesn't — it switches to chunked diff mode automatically. Chunks are hashed and compared server-side, so only changed regions stream to your browser. If the viewer looks stuck, it's usually the sync cache, not the diff. Clear it from Settings → Storage. To rebuild the cache index you need access to the Moorfell admin vault, so use the recovery passphrase below.

vault phrase of taweg-kafof = oliax-zorael

Handing off the Quillbus broker upgrade (4.x to 5.1) to Dario. Cluster is half-migrated; mixed-version mode is supported but TLS cert rotation must finish before cutover. No auth model changes, though the admin API gained two new endpoints worth reviewing. Open questions and the migration checklist are tracked on the internal page below.

dashboard of taduf-bawef = https://jira.lumicsys.internal/projects/display/browse/b1cbf89d

# Webhook Retry Environment Variables

Pindrop delivers webhooks with exponential backoff: 5 attempts, base delay 30s, capped at 15m. `PINDROP_RETRY_MAX=5` and `PINDROP_RETRY_BASE_MS=30000` control this; don't change them without sign-off from the delivery team. Failed deliveries land in the dead-letter queue after the final attempt. Retries are signed so receivers can verify origin, and the signing secret lives in the worker's env file on the line below.

vault entry, yahif-yajep: COURIER_KEY29=b802bdf8034096b65a51c6ba5abe2

## Runbook: Nightly Search Reindex (Quillfeather)

Heads up for the security review: the reindex job kicks off at 02:10 and runs under the `reindex-bot` service account — read-only on content tables, write on the index shards. It never touches user credentials. Logs land in the Quillfeather audit bucket with a 90-day retention. If the job hangs past 04:00, kill it and rerun manually. The job reads source rows using the connection string below.

primary connection of yagep-kahip = redis://giliel_svc:zYiKsLL2PLpfPL@db-348f.xolmarsys.corp:5432/fenwyn